* Fix trust policy wildcard principal handling

This change fixes the trust policy validation to properly support
AWS-standard wildcard principals like {"Federated": "*"}.

Previously, the evaluatePrincipalValue() function would check for
context existence before evaluating wildcards, causing wildcard
principals to fail when the context key didn't exist. This forced
users to use the plain "*" workaround instead of the more specific
{"Federated": "*"} format.

Changes:
- Modified evaluatePrincipalValue() to check for "*" FIRST before
  validating against context
- Added support for wildcards in principal arrays
- Added comprehensive tests for wildcard principal handling
- All existing tests continue to pass (no regressions)

This matches AWS IAM behavior where "*" in a principal field means
"allow any value" without requiring context validation.

Fixes: https://github.com/seaweedfs/seaweedfs/issues/7917

* fix: avoid copying lock values in protobuf messages

- Use proto.Merge() instead of direct assignment to avoid copying sync.Mutex in S3ApiConfiguration (iamapi_server.go)
- Add explicit comments noting that channel-received values are already copies before taking addresses (volume_grpc_client_to_master.go)

The protobuf messages contain sync.Mutex fields from the message state, which should not be copied.
Using proto.Merge() properly merges messages without copying the embedded mutex.

* fix: correct byte array size for uint32 bit shift operations

The generateAccountId() function only needs 4 bytes to create a uint32 value.
Changed from allocating 8 bytes to 4 bytes to match the actual usage.

This fixes go vet warning about shifting 8-bit values (bytes) by more than 8 bits.

* fix: ensure context cancellation on all error paths

In broker_client_subscribe.go, ensure subscriberCancel() is called on all error return paths:
- When stream creation fails
- When partition assignment fails
- When sending initialization message fails

This prevents context leaks when an error occurs during subscriber creation.
